As part of the treatment team the Case Manager Supervisor plans directs and coordinates the activities of the Case Managers within the youth housing community programming; oversees the Case Management team to ensure it meets agency expectations and goals; ensures the Case Management team maintains compliance with agency and/or grant requirements; assesses Case Management needs develops goals and ensures that the Case Management team has a cooperative working relationship with all of the programs that they serve and overarching within the agency itself; supervises assigned staff and assists them in their job duties.
II. DUTIES & 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S
Manage Case Management team to ensure it operates within the rules regulations and guidelines set forth by the agency HAND expectations and COA.
Establish and oversee administrative procedures to meet objectives set by the program director and senior management in each program; participate in developing department goals and objectives.
Establish and maintain Case Management systems records and reports; recommend new approaches policies and procedures for continual improvement of Case Management services.
Supervise assigned staff and volunteers to ensure that they are functioning within the requirements of their job duties; provide guidance training assistance and support to staff when needed including planning performance management professional development adjusting workloads as necessary and addressing and resolving complaints to create a climate of teamwork and motivation.
Act as expert for external partners; work with the program director regarding Case Management or program licensing/certification rules relicensing complaints and rulings to ensure ongoing compliance with all agencies licensing contractual and legal obligations and requirements.
Operate within the guidelines of the Employee Handbook programs Operations Manual Policies and Procedures and grant guidelines.
Demonstrate commitment to the social sector with a passion for MCHSs mission and vision.
Other duties as assigned.
